tTorrent features and specs

  • High Speed Downloads
    tTorrent offers high-speed file downloads, leveraging the power of the BitTorrent protocol to efficiently manage and download large files quickly.
  • Partial Download Capability
    The app allows users to download specific files from a torrent package, providing flexibility in downloads and conserving bandwidth.
  • Sequential Download
    Users can download files in sequence, which is particularly useful for streaming media files directly as they download.
  • Advanced Features
    tTorrent provides advanced features like RSS feed support and proxy support, which cater to more experienced users looking for comprehensive torrent management.
  • User-friendly Interface
    tTorrent has a clean, intuitive user interface that makes it easy for both beginners and experienced users to navigate and use the app.

Possible disadvantages of tTorrent

  • Potential Legal Issues
    Using BitTorrent clients like tTorrent can potentially lead to legal issues, as downloading copyrighted content without proper authorization is often illegal.
  • Battery Drain
    Running tTorrent, especially for prolonged periods, can lead to significant battery drain on mobile devices.
  • Data Usage
    Downloading large files over mobile networks can consume considerable data, leading to high mobile data charges.
  • Security Risks
    Torrenting can pose security risks, as files can sometimes contain malware or viruses that can harm your device.
  • Ads in Free Version
    The free version of tTorrent contains ads, which can be intrusive and degrade the user experience.

LibreTorrent features and specs

  • Open Source
    LibreTorrent is an open-source project, which means its code is publicly available for review, modification, and contribution. This ensures transparency in its development process and allows users to inspect the software for security and privacy concerns.
  • No Ads
    Unlike many torrent clients available on mobile platforms, LibreTorrent does not include any advertisements, providing a cleaner and distraction-free user experience.
  • Customizable Settings
    The app offers a variety of settings and configurations, allowing users to customize how torrents are downloaded, managed, and prioritized.
  • Material Design
    It features a user-friendly interface built with Material Design principles, which makes it intuitive and easy to navigate for users.
  • Privacy Focused
    LibreTorrent includes features that enhance user privacy, such as support for proxy servers and encryption options, enabling safer torrenting practices.

Possible disadvantages of LibreTorrent

  • Platform Limitation
    LibreTorrent is currently available only on Android, which limits its availability to users on iOS or other operating systems who might be looking for a similar open-source torrent client.
  • No Built-in Search
    The application does not include a built-in torrent search feature, requiring users to find and download torrent files from external sources.
  • Potential Stability Issues
    As with many open-source projects developed by small teams or individuals, users might sometimes encounter bugs or stability issues, especially on less common device configurations.
  • Limited Support
    Being an open-source project without commercial backing, official support channels are limited. Users generally rely on community forums and GitHub for help.
